Rosa’s Pizza might not look like much from the outside, but locals know it houses some of the best New York-style pizza in northern Arizona. The modest storefront in a small commercial building hides ...
Venezia’s clean white exterior gives way to a pizzeria that truly delivers New York flavor in Arizona. Their sign glows red against the white building, letting you know you’ve found the right place.